Helen Mae Sweeney, 87, of Lansing, formerly of Cedar Rapids, passed away early Thursday, September 8, 2016.

Funeral Mass: 11:00 A.M. Monday at Saint Wenceslaus Catholic Church by Father Christopher Podhajsky. Burial will follow at Saint John's Cemetery. Visitation for family and close friends will be from 9:30 to 10:30 A.M. Monday at Papich-Kuba Funeral Home East, 1228 2nd Street S.E., Cedar Rapids.

Helen was born August 23, 1929 in Cedar Rapids to Joe and Olga (Andrle) Pisney. She was a 1947 graduate of Saint Wenceslaus High School and attended Mount Mercy College. Helen was employed by the Cedar Rapids Public Library extension on 16th Avenue S.W. and at United State Bank in Czech Village.

She married Connie Joe Sweeney on February 26, 1949 at Saint Wenceslaus Catholic Church. They farmed near Waukon for two years before moving back to Cedar Rapids, where she devoted her life to raising their four children.

Helen is survived by her daughter, Joan Morandi (Larry) of Aurora, Colorado and sons, Larry (Deb) of Lansing, Richard of Monterey Park, California and Dan (Sherry) of Cedar Rapids; her grandchildren, Matt Sweeney (Casey), Jennifer Morandi-Benson (Brian), Greg Sweeney (Heather), Brian Morandi and John Sweeney; and her great-grandchildren: T.J., Emma, Owen, Caleb and Justin Sweeney. She is also survived by her sister, Virginia Evans of Fairfax and brother, George Pisney of Iowa City.

She was preceded in death by her husband, Connie; her parents, grandparents, John and Bessie Andrle and Frank and Mary Pisney and her brother, John.

Helen's five grandchildren and five great-grandchildren were the joy of her life. She was always very proud of her Czech heritage.
